Job description
Experienced IT professional to lead end-user support and service delivery across corporate and field environments. This role acts as a senior escalation point, mentor, and strategic partner, focused on improving IT services, user experience, and operational efficiency.
-
Serve as the top escalation resource for complex technical issues
-
Mentor junior staff and promote a high-performance service culture
-
Align IT services with business and jobsite needs
-
Implement and manage ITIL processes (incident, problem, change)
-
Design and maintain service catalog, SLAs, and support models (L1/L2/L3)
-
Improve service delivery through automation, self-service, and process optimization
-
Provide advanced support for Microsoft 365, endpoints, enterprise apps, and identity/access
-
Manage device lifecycle (procurement through refresh)
-
Analyze service metrics and drive continuous improvement
-
Support and lead IT projects and initiatives
Requirements
-
5 -10+ years in IT support or operations
-
Strong experience with ITSM, ITIL, Microsoft 365, Windows, and identity management
-
Proven ability to handle escalations and lead improvements
-
Experience supporting large or field-based organizations preferred
-
Excellent communication and stakeholder engagement skills
Benefits & conditions
Consistently regarded as one of Chicago’s largest and most respected General Contractors.
- Competitive salary ranging from $90,000 to $105,000 USD.
- Permanent role in the business services industry.
